Capacity note for Ledgerpane plugin authors: the audit-log viewer streams pages from cold storage, so plugin queries are metered per tenant. Heavy scans get queued, not rejected. Budget for worst-case pagination — assume 90-day retention and full-index fallback. Plugins exceeding the scan quota are deferred to the off-peak lane. The current metering constants are shown below.

constants for yajof-hadup:
RATE_LIMITS = {
    "druael": 2,
    "ralael": 10,
}

TICKET-4412: Font vendoring blocked by locked Glyphhaven vault. While migrating the Brimfold UI to vendored third-party fonts, we discovered the license archive sits in a vault that auto-locked after Dessa's rotation lapsed. Legal needs the originals before we can ship. For the weekly sync: unlocking requires the recovery passphrase, which is recorded below.

strongbox words: sorir-belvan-rusix-ulays-ralmir-praix-eliir-tamax-praael-druael-julir-tamius-jorir

Action item: retire the homegrown Brindlecart job queue and migrate all deferred tasks to Ashfall Relay by the end of next cycle. Support should be aware that during the transition, tickets mentioning stuck exports or duplicate notification emails are almost certainly queue-related and should be tagged accordingly, not escalated to the Pellworth apps team. Relay's behavior is governed by a small set of tuning knobs that we have pre-set for our workload, and the values we are launching with are shown below.

constants for fajop-tahaf:
RATE_LIMITS = {
    "holael": 2,
    "oliael": 10,
    "druael": 10,
    "wenwyn": 10,
}